(Video) TRIUMPH - Live 101

Welcome to our inaugural "Live 101" video series where we shine a spotlight on a band's discography by viewing some of their best live performances in a compact 40 minutes (or so).

Kicking things off is Canada's rock'n'roll machine TRIUMPH, a band with unquestionably a questionable discography (!), but with enough individual tracks along the way to warrant the Live 101 treatment as you'll see/hear.

Come join the Allied Forces!!

